2Types of Personal Data We Collect
Ovvo99 only collects data that is strictly necessary to provide a safe, fair, and legally compliant service. The data we collect falls into three main categories:
| Data Category | Data Examples | Collection Method |
|---|---|---|
| Identity Data | Full name, date of birth, identity card number (MyKad/passport), facial photo | Registration form, KYC process |
| Contact Data | Email address, phone number, residential address | Registration form, profile updates |
| Financial Data | Bank account number, bank name, deposit and withdrawal records | First deposit/withdrawal process |
| Usage Data | Game history, activity logs, pages visited, session duration | Automated system logs |
| Technical Data | IP address, device type, operating system, browser version, device ID | Cookies, mobile app SDKs |
| Communication Data | Live chat conversation transcripts, support email content, complaint feedback | Interactions with the support team |

7Data Retention Period
Ovvo99 does not retain your personal data longer than necessary. Retention periods are determined based on the purpose of data collection and applicable legal requirements:
- Active account data: Retained for as long as your account is active or as long as required to provide the service
- KYC and financial data: Retained for a minimum of 7 years after account closure, in line with Malaysian legal requirements relating to AML and tax reporting
- Activity and game logs: Retained for 2 years for security, dispute resolution, and audit purposes
- Support communication data: Retained for 1 year after case resolution
- Marketing data: Retained until you withdraw consent or close your account
Once the retention period expires, your data will be securely deleted or anonymised so that it can no longer be linked to you as an individual.

9Cookies and Tracking Technology
Ovvo99 uses cookies and similar technologies to enhance your experience on our platform. Cookies are small text files stored on your device when you visit the ovvo99 website. The types of cookies we use include:
- Essential cookies (required): Required for core platform functions such as login session verification and security. These cookies cannot be disabled.
- Preference cookies: Remembering your language settings, display preferences, and personal preferences for a more comfortable experience
- Analytics cookies: Collecting aggregate information on how users interact with the platform to help us improve design and content
- Security cookies: Helping detect fraudulent activity and verifying that login sessions are legitimate
You can manage cookie settings through your browser preferences. However, disabling essential cookies may affect the functionality of the ovvo99 platform. For more information on managing cookies, refer to your browser's help guide.
